mirror of https://github.com/kubernetes/kops.git
Merge pull request #16117 from zetaab/skipfilerepository
skip file remapping if same host
This commit is contained in:
commit
6977243608
|
@ -250,14 +250,15 @@ func (a *AssetBuilder) RemapFileAndSHA(fileURL *url.URL) (*url.URL, *hashing.Has
|
||||||
|
|
||||||
if a.AssetsLocation != nil && a.AssetsLocation.FileRepository != nil {
|
if a.AssetsLocation != nil && a.AssetsLocation.FileRepository != nil {
|
||||||
|
|
||||||
normalizedFileURL, err := a.remapURL(fileURL)
|
normalizedFile, err := a.remapURL(fileURL)
|
||||||
if err != nil {
|
if err != nil {
|
||||||
return nil, nil, err
|
return nil, nil, err
|
||||||
}
|
}
|
||||||
|
|
||||||
fileAsset.DownloadURL = normalizedFileURL
|
if fileURL.Host != normalizedFile.Host {
|
||||||
|
fileAsset.DownloadURL = normalizedFile
|
||||||
klog.V(4).Infof("adding remapped file: %+v", fileAsset)
|
klog.V(4).Infof("adding remapped file: %q", fileAsset.DownloadURL.String())
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
h, err := a.findHash(fileAsset)
|
h, err := a.findHash(fileAsset)
|
||||||
|
@ -289,9 +290,10 @@ func (a *AssetBuilder) RemapFileAndSHAValue(fileURL *url.URL, shaValue string) (
|
||||||
if err != nil {
|
if err != nil {
|
||||||
return nil, err
|
return nil, err
|
||||||
}
|
}
|
||||||
|
if fileURL.Host != normalizedFile.Host {
|
||||||
fileAsset.DownloadURL = normalizedFile
|
fileAsset.DownloadURL = normalizedFile
|
||||||
klog.V(4).Infof("adding remapped file: %q", fileAsset.DownloadURL.String())
|
klog.V(4).Infof("adding remapped file: %q", fileAsset.DownloadURL.String())
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
klog.V(8).Infof("adding file: %+v", fileAsset)
|
klog.V(8).Infof("adding file: %+v", fileAsset)
|
||||||
|
|
Loading…
Reference in New Issue